How Detoxification Works in Bevington, Iowa

For a lot of clients in a drug and alcohol addiction treatment center, the first stages of detoxification can be severe. As a direct result, the program may have mental health and medical professionals standing by to provide you with the effective support, management, and oversight you require as your body gets rid of the drugs and alcohol you previously consumed.

For example, several hours following administration of your last heroin dose, you might experience withdrawal, which may be expressed as:

  • Agitation
  • Anxiety
  • Excessive yawning
  • Increasing tearing of the eyes
  • Difficulty sleeping
  • Muscle aches
  • Runny nose
  • Sweating

Even though you may think that these symptoms will not threaten your life, it is likely they may be so uncomfortable that you would be tempted to start abusing heroin again. This is why you should receive medical and psychiatric care while undergoing detox.

Additionally, you may need to endure other problems when you check into a detox facility - particularly in the first couple of hours after your last dose of the drugs your body is dependent on.

During this time, the detoxification program in Bevington will deal with the most urgent of these problems initially before they achieve full stabilization. Some issues you might experience may include:

  • Injury
  • Medical illness
  • Symptoms of psychosis
  • Threat to self
  • Violence

You may also experience intense cravings for your preferred intoxicating and mind-altering substances. To ensure that you do not relapse, the detox may administer certain replacement medications or taper you off from these substances.
